Why is Polycarbonate resistant to Arsenic Acid?

Polycarbonate shows excellent resistance to Arsenic Acid due to its carbonate group structure, though it has limited chemical resistance compared to other engineering plastics.

⚠️ When NOT to use Polycarbonate

Avoid using Polycarbonate with alkalis, amines, ketones, esters, and many organic solvents. Prone to stress cracking.
